Output 7568bb1884ae2ea1db5dffe751f3a7e6fc28a2b674b0cdfc3f18f9e72f63bf81:12

value
30591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8c691fbd0cb036f45039c391e40db0b00ce1642 OP_EQUAL
address
3QNRP293igHRWC1sELCMSCJ1QoYqMWTwam
transaction
7568bb1884ae2ea1db5dffe751f3a7e6fc28a2b674b0cdfc3f18f9e72f63bf81
spent
true